Program Architecture & Curriculum Design
- Design, structure, and continuously evolve the curriculum architecture for the BMS and BMAGD programs, ensuring alignment with UGC/MAKAUT norms and evolving industry requirements.
- Build integrated academic plans, course maps, and assessment models for both programs in coordination with the Academic team.
- Benchmark program structure against industry and market trends in media, animation, and game design to keep curriculum future-ready.
- Lead periodic curriculum review and revision cycles, incorporating faculty, student, and industry feedback.
Academic Delivery & Monitoring
- Take overall responsibility for planning and monitoring of program delivery across the BMS and BMAGD departments.
- Oversee routine academic operations – subject allocation, resource allocation, and scheduling – for both programs.
- Conduct daily and quarterly monitoring of academic delivery for students and faculty members across both departments.
- Ensure timely completion of practical sessions, sessional papers, and internal examinations as per university norms, with data entered into the MAKAUT portal.
Teaching & Student Skilling
- Teach core and elective courses within the BMS and BMAGD curricula as required.
- Train and skill students in Production – covering camera & lighting and on-set filmmaking practices – and in animation/game design workflows relevant to BMAGD.
- Train and skill students in Post-Production – covering video editing, finishing workflows, and multimedia output.
- Provide mentorship to students across both programs, guiding them through hands-on production, post-production, animation, and game design projects.
- Introduce and integrate recent technologies, applications, and digital platforms into teaching delivery for both programs.
Industry Collaboration, Internship & Placement
- Cultivate collaborative partnerships with media, animation, and gaming industry experts for curriculum input, guest sessions, and student opportunities.
- Coordinate training and placement activities for final-year batches of BMS and BMAGD in partnership with the Placement Cell.
- Create networking opportunities and facilitate internships and placements, tracking soft-skill training schedules and progress.
- Align department goals with the institution’s strategic plan through collaboration with the Corporate Relations team.
Administrative Responsibilities
- Act as a passionate advocate for the college, promoting the strengths and academic offerings of the BMS and BMAGD programs.
- Manage department activities and events for both programs, ensuring visibility in institutional systems (e.g., Camu).
- Conduct quarterly assessments of departmental activities and incorporate outcomes into OKRs as per institutional requirements.
